100G and 200G per Lane Linear Drive Optics for Data Center

100G/lane linear-drive pluggable optics demonstrate interoperability with over 3 dB link margin. Simulations suggest that 200G/lane linear drive requires bump-to-bump losses below 22 dB, but

MACOM to Demonstrate 100G/Lane High Speed Optical Link with Linear

A Linear Drive architecture eliminates the Digital Signal Processor (DSP) from pluggable optical modules while lowering power consumption, improving signal latency and reducing cost.
